Chelsea Library news
TAMA NEWS-HERALD – library has children’s story hour every Monday at 10:30 a.m.
Book club meets every third Thursday at 6p.m. This month the Station Street Readers are reading The Forgotten Garden by Kate Morton. If you’re interested in joining the book club contact the library at 641-489-2525.
The library now offers Tumble Books. E-books for e-kids. Stop in or call the library for more information.
